How To Avoid Phishing Attacks Via iPhone Messages

How To Avoid Phishing Attacks

Phishing attacks aimed at stealing personal information are an increasingly serious threat for iPhone users. A phishing scam typically starts with a text message that appears trustworthy but contains a malicious link. Tapping on that link from the iPhone's Messages app can send you to a convincing but fake website designed to steal your login credentials, financial info, or install malware on your device.

It's important to be vigilant about spotting and avoiding iPhone phishing scams. Once criminals get access to your sensitive data, they can exploit it in many harmful ways, like draining your bank account, making unauthorized credit card charges, or stealing your identity. Here are some helpful tips to keep your iPhone and personal information safe from phishing attacks received through text messages or SMS:

Watch Out for Unexpected Messages from Unknown Senders

The first red flag of a phishing attempt is receiving a text out of the blue from a phone number you don't recognize. Phishing texts often impersonate a company you do business with, such as your bank, credit card issuer, a retailer, or an online service. The message will be crafted to appear legitimate and urge you to click a link to secure your account or claim a deal.

But phishing links are sent from phone numbers that don't match the real company. Any unexpected text from an unknown number should be treated cautiously. Don't click on any links right away. Instead, contact the company through their official website or app to ask about the suspicious text.

Check for Signs of Number Spoofing

Clever phishing scammers can “spoof” legitimate phone numbers, so the incoming text appears to come from a source you trust. But iPhone has some ways to detect likely spoofing. Look for a tiny “S” or “US” icon next to the phone number in the text - that's Apple's way of labeling suspected spoofed numbers.

You can tap on the message header with the number to see more details about the source. Educate yourself on how spoofing works so you can better identify it. If a text claims to be your bank but the phone number is clearly fake, it's almost certainly a phish.

Don't Click on Suspicious Links Right Away

Whenever you receive a questionable text with a link, don't tap on it immediately. Phishing links are designed to look convincingly like real websites in the SMS preview. Instead of clicking directly, tap and hold on the link to bring up a menu allowing you to copy the URL or share it.

Paste the copied link into the Notes app, then inspect it closely for any misspellings, odd domains, or other signs it's a fake before clicking. Verifying links in this way takes a little extra time, but could save you from visiting malicious sites or handing over your iPhone data.

Turn On "Filter Unknown Senders"

An important iPhone anti-phishing feature to enable is the “Filter Unknown Senders” option under Messages settings. This automatically filters SMS messages from phone numbers not already in your contacts to the spam folder.

While legitimate messages could accidentally get blocked, it's a helpful precaution. You can still look in spam periodically for unknown senders you're expecting texts from. Just be aware texts from unknown senders won't hit your main inbox with filtering on.

Don't Enable Text Message Forwarding

Text message forwarding allows texts received on your iPhone to be sent automatically to other devices. This can be a useful feature but also poses security risks. Phishing texts forwarded to your other devices could compromise multiple accounts. Keep the text forwarding option turned off to limit where phishing attempts can reach.

Set Up Two-Factor Authentication

For important accounts like banking, email, and social media, set up two-factor authentication (2FA). 2FA requires you to enter a unique code from a separate device when logging in from a new iPhone. So even if phishers steal your password, they still can't access your accounts without that extra code from your phone.

The extra login step keeps your sensitive data much more secure against phishing attempts. Enable 2FA everywhere it's available.

Monitor Your Accounts and Credit Regularly

Make it a habit to closely monitor bank, credit card, and online accounts at least weekly for any unauthorized access, charges, or suspicious activity. Fast detection of anything amiss after a phishing attempt can help limit the damage. Enabling transaction alerts is also wise.

Learn to Recognize Phishing Red Flags

Educate yourself on common phishing tactics, email and text message red flags, and ways attackers try to spoof legitimate companies. Understanding mobile phishing techniques makes their scams easier to spot. Stay on top of the latest phishing trends so you can keep your iPhone secure.

Don't Reply To Any Suspicious Texts

If you receive a text you believe to be a phishing attempt, don't reply to it at all - not even to say "stop" or "unsubscribe." Any response verifies to scammers that they reached a real, active phone number. Instead, block the number, report it to your carrier, and delete the text. Avoid engaging phishers.

Conclusion

By following these tips, you can enjoy all the convenient communication iPhone offers while avoiding dangerous phishing scams. Be wary of any unexpected text from an unknown number, don't blindly click links, enable key iPhone security settings, and monitor your accounts regularly. Putting some care into mobile security will keep you safe from phishers aiming to steal your personal information and money.
